开源音乐软件MuseScore音色配置与音频优化全指南
一、概念解析:MuseScore声音系统架构
在数字音乐制作中,音色是音乐表达的核心载体。MuseScore作为开源音乐制谱软件的代表,其声音系统基于多层级架构设计,主要包含三个核心组成部分:声音字体(SoundFonts)、乐器定义系统和MIDI映射机制。
声音字体是一种特殊的音频文件格式(通常为SF2或SF3),它包含了多种乐器的采样数据和演奏技法信息。与传统音频文件不同,声音字体本质上是一个音色数据库,能够根据MIDI指令实时合成不同音高、力度的音符。MuseScore默认提供两个高质量声音字体:FluidR3Mono_GM.sf3(通用MIDI标准音色库)和MS Basic.sf3(针对制谱优化的精简音色库),这两个文件均位于项目的share/sound/目录下。
乐器定义系统通过XML配置文件实现对乐器属性的精细控制。核心配置文件share/instruments/instruments.xml包含了乐器分类体系、音域范围、MIDI程序号映射等关键信息。该文件采用层级结构设计,将乐器分为木管、铜管、弦乐、打击乐等多个家族,每个家族下的乐器又包含详细的演奏技法定义。
MIDI映射机制则负责将乐谱中的音符信息转换为声音字体可以识别的MIDI指令。这个过程涉及音高转换、力度映射、通道分配等复杂处理,是连接视觉乐谱与听觉效果的关键桥梁。
专业提示:理解声音字体的采样率和位深特性对音色质量至关重要。通常来说,44.1kHz采样率和16位深度的声音字体既能保证音质,又能兼顾性能。
二、核心功能:MuseScore音色管理系统
MuseScore的音色管理系统提供了从基础配置到高级定制的完整功能集,主要包括以下四个方面:
1. 声音字体管理机制
软件内置了声音字体加载器,支持SF2/SF3格式文件的自动识别与加载。在share/sound/目录中,除默认音色库外,用户还可以添加第三方声音字体文件。系统会自动扫描该目录并更新可用音色列表,无需手动配置路径。
2. 乐器库组织架构
乐器库采用模块化设计,通过instruments.xml文件实现灵活扩展。每个乐器定义包含以下关键参数:
- 乐器ID与名称(支持多语言本地化)
- MIDI程序号与银行选择器
- 音域上下限(最低/最高音)
- 推荐音量与声像位置
- 打击乐映射表(针对打击乐器)
3. 混音器控制面板
混音器是实时调整音色参数的核心界面,可通过F10快捷键打开。面板提供多轨独立控制,包括音量推子(0-127)、声像旋钮(-100至+100)、效果器开关等。高级模式下还可调整混响深度、合唱效果等参数,实现专业级音频处理。
4. MuseSounds高级音色引擎
MuseScore提供的MuseSounds引擎是新一代采样技术的代表,通过多动态层采样和圆形立体声技术实现更真实的乐器表现力。该引擎支持自动表情控制和技法切换,特别适合演奏复杂的古典音乐作品。
三、实践指南:从基础配置到高级应用
基础配置流程:声音字体安装与切换
-
声音字体安装
- 操作步骤:将下载的SF2/SF3文件复制到share/sound/目录
- 验证方法:重启MuseScore后,在混音器的"音色库"下拉菜单中查看新增选项
- 效果对比:未安装时仅显示默认音色库,安装后列表会包含新添加的声音字体名称
-
音轨音色分配
- 操作步骤:
- 打开混音器(F10)
- 选择目标音轨
- 在"音色"下拉菜单中选择所需乐器
- 调整音量至-6dB(推荐起始值)
- 效果对比:分配前后的音色变化可通过播放同一小节进行直观比较
- 操作步骤:
-
MIDI输出配置
- 操作步骤:
- 打开"编辑"→"首选项"→"I/O"
- 在"MIDI输出"部分选择目标设备
- 启用"软件合成器"选项
- 常见误区:将MIDI输出设备设置为外部合成器时,需确保声音字体选择为"无",否则会产生双重发声
- 操作步骤:
中级应用:多音色分层设置
多音色分层是高级制作中的重要技巧,允许同一音轨在不同音高区域使用不同音色:
-
创建音色层
- 操作步骤:
- 在混音器中右键点击音轨
- 选择"添加音色层"
- 为新层分配不同音色
- 效果对比:原始单一音色与分层后的音色变化在音域过渡处尤为明显
- 操作步骤:
-
设置分层触发条件
- 操作步骤:
- 双击音色层打开高级设置
- 设置"触发音高范围"
- 调整交叉渐变区间(推荐2-3个半音)
- 专业提示:弦乐器可在高把位使用独奏音色,低把位使用合奏音色,提升表现力
- 操作步骤:
四、进阶技巧:音频优化与性能调优
音色参数精细调整
-
动态响应曲线校准
- 操作步骤:
- 打开"视图"→"音轨参数"
- 调整"力度曲线"斜率(推荐值1.2-1.5)
- 测试不同力度下的音色变化
- 效果对比:调整前后在forte(f)和piano(p)力度下的动态范围差异
- 操作步骤:
-
效果器链配置
- 操作步骤:
- 在混音器中点击"效果"按钮
- 添加压缩器(比率4:1,阈值-18dB)
- 添加混响(房间大小30%,湿信号20%)
- 常见误区:过度使用混响会导致声音模糊,建议湿信号比例不超过30%
- 操作步骤:
第三方声音字体兼容性处理
-
格式转换与优化
- 操作步骤:
- 使用Audacity打开原始SF2文件
- 批量转换采样率至44.1kHz
- 导出为SF3格式(压缩比60%)
- 效果对比:优化后的文件大小减少约50%,加载速度提升明显
- 操作步骤:
-
音色映射修正
- 操作步骤:
- 编辑share/instruments/instruments.xml
- 调整目标乐器的值
- 添加标签指定音色库编号
- 专业提示:第三方音色库的MIDI映射可能与GM标准不符,需参考其技术文档进行调整
- 操作步骤:
附录:性能优化检查表
硬件资源优化
- [ ] CPU:确保占用率低于70%(可通过任务管理器监控)
- [ ] 内存:至少保留2GB空闲内存用于声音字体加载
- [ ] 存储:声音字体所在分区剩余空间>10GB
软件设置优化
- [ ] 声音字体:优先使用SF3格式(比SF2节省约40%空间)
- [ ] 采样质量:普通项目使用16位/44.1kHz,专业项目可提升至24位/48kHz
- [ ] 效果器:仅在必要时启用,建议不超过3个效果器同时运行
- [ ] 多线程:在"首选项→性能"中启用多线程合成(如支持)
故障排除指南
- [ ] 声音卡顿:降低采样质量或关闭不必要的效果器
- [ ] 音色缺失:检查sound目录权限及文件完整性
- [ ] 加载缓慢:将常用声音字体放置在SSD驱动器
通过系统学习本指南,即使是初次接触MuseScore的用户也能掌握从基础配置到高级优化的完整流程。合理利用开源音乐软件的乐器采样管理功能,不仅能提升乐谱的听觉表现,还能为音乐创作提供更广阔的可能性。记住,优质的音色配置是连接视觉乐谱与听觉艺术的关键桥梁。
atomcodeClaude Code 的开源替代方案。连接任意大模型,编辑代码,运行命令,自动验证 — 全自动执行。用 Rust 构建,极致性能。 | An open-source alternative to Claude Code. Connect any LLM, edit code, run commands, and verify changes — autonomously. Built in Rust for speed. Get StartedRust0153- DDeepSeek-V4-ProDeepSeek-V4-Pro(总参数 1.6 万亿,激活 49B)面向复杂推理和高级编程任务,在代码竞赛、数学推理、Agent 工作流等场景表现优异,性能接近国际前沿闭源模型。Python00
LongCat-Video-Avatar-1.5最新开源LongCat-Video-Avatar 1.5 版本,这是一款经过升级的开源框架,专注于音频驱动人物视频生成的极致实证优化与生产级就绪能力。该版本在 LongCat-Video 基础模型之上构建,可生成高度稳定的商用级虚拟人视频,支持音频-文本转视频(AT2V)、音频-文本-图像转视频(ATI2V)以及视频续播等原生任务,并能无缝兼容单流与多流音频输入。00
auto-devAutoDev 是一个 AI 驱动的辅助编程插件。AutoDev 支持一键生成测试、代码、提交信息等,还能够与您的需求管理系统(例如Jira、Trello、Github Issue 等)直接对接。 在IDE 中,您只需简单点击,AutoDev 会根据您的需求自动为您生成代码。Kotlin03
Intern-S2-PreviewIntern-S2-Preview,这是一款高效的350亿参数科学多模态基础模型。除了常规的参数与数据规模扩展外,Intern-S2-Preview探索了任务扩展:通过提升科学任务的难度、多样性与覆盖范围,进一步释放模型能力。Python00
skillhubopenJiuwen 生态的 Skill 托管与分发开源方案,支持自建与可选 ClawHub 兼容。Python0112
